Samantha Ruth Prabhu Embraces New Beginnings This Makar Sankranti

Actor Samantha Ruth Prabhu recently celebrated Makar Sankranti in a special way, marking the occasion for the first time with her husband, producer Raj Nidimoru. She shared a playful selfie with him, highlighting the festive spirit of the day.

On Thursday, Samantha took to her Instagram Stories to give fans a glimpse of their celebration. In a cute selfie, they are seen posing in traditional red outfits, with Samantha making a goofy face and Raj smiling beside her. Captured in a car, the couple’s attire and expressions conveyed the cheerful Sankranthi vibes.

Makar Sankranti, also referred to as Uttarayana, is a significant Hindu festival celebrated across India and Nepal. It represents the Sun’s transition into Capricorn and symbolizes new beginnings, hope, and prosperity.

Recently, Samantha and Raj were seen arriving at Hyderabad airport, capturing attention on social media. Videos from their outing showcased Samantha’s stylish look, accentuated by her mangalsutra, which became a focal point of admiration among fans.

The couple tied the knot on December 1 of the previous year in Coimbatore during a serene, yogic wedding ceremony. Their nuptials were a surprise to fans, who were thrilled upon seeing the pictures that Samantha shared. After their wedding, they took a romantic getaway to Lisbon, Portugal.

Samantha had previously collaborated with Raj & DK on the web series “The Family Man 2” and “Citadel: Honey Bunny” in 2023. After her divorce from Naga Chaitanya in 2021, both Samantha and Raj kept their relationship private for a period. Speculation about their romance grew when they were frequently spotted together, which they eventually confirmed following their marriage.

Currently, Samantha is working alongside Raj & DK on their upcoming project titled “Rakt Brahmand: The Bloody Kingdom.
